Q: Can contractors use the quiet room on the top floor of Brindlehall House? A: Yes, provided work there is pre-approved by the site supervisor and noise is kept to a minimum. The room sits behind the stairwell door on level nine, which remains locked at all times. To release that door, enter the pass code shown below.

turnstile pass: bdg-TXR-4

Handover: TranscodeMeadow farm

Handing this off before I rotate out. Plugin authors: the farm runs Strettle workers in pools keyed by codec; your plugin registers a profile and gets scheduled accordingly. Don't assume GPU nodes — half the fleet is CPU-only. Job retries are capped at three, then the job lands in the dead-letter queue, which plugins can poll. Logs are per-job, rotated daily. Everything you need to target the current environment is in the config block below.

settings of fajop-fahap:
[holeth]
port = 9300
team = juleth
host = holeth.tolvaqsoft.example
region = south-4
access_code = ac_4bcdf6
timeout_ms = 500

**Action item (INC follow-up): Varrow Assign service**

Sticky assignments expired early during the outage, so some users flipped experiment arms mid-session. Support: if customers report inconsistent features, check assignment timestamps before escalating. Fix shipped; TTLs and cache bounds were retuned to prevent recurrence. Do not manually reassign users. Escalate only if flips persist past the new TTL window. Revised constants are listed below.

tuning table, yaweg-kajef:
WEIGHTS = {
    "ralwyn": 573,
    "praius": 56,
    "eliok": 19,
}

## Deployment

Quick notes for the sync: the Mosslight profile store is now sharded by user ID across eight nodes, with the Tanager router handling lookups. Resharding is online-only — please don't run the legacy rebalance script. Each router instance boots with the following configuration values.

settings of baweg-tadup:
[julwyn]
host = julwyn.novacdata.internal
user = julwyn_svc
database = julwyn_prod